在电商领域,数据是决策的重要依据。而echarts堆积图作为一种强大的可视化工具,能够帮助我们直观地分析销量趋势和产品关联。本文将带您深入了解echarts堆积图的应用,让您轻松解读电商数据。
一、echarts堆积图简介
echarts堆积图是一种基于JavaScript的图表库,可以轻松实现各种图表的绘制。堆积图是一种组合图表,可以同时展示多个数据系列,并按顺序堆叠。通过堆积图,我们可以清晰地看到不同数据系列之间的趋势和关联。
二、echarts堆积图在电商数据分析中的应用
1. 销量趋势分析
通过echarts堆积图,我们可以将不同时间段的销量数据以堆叠的形式展示出来。这样,我们可以直观地观察到销量随时间的变化趋势,从而为库存管理、促销活动等提供决策依据。
示例代码:
// 引入echarts
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: '销量趋势'
},
tooltip: {},
legend: {
data:['商品A', '商品B', '商品C']
},
xAxis: {
data: ["1月", "2月", "3月", "4月", "5月", "6月"]
},
yAxis: {},
series: [{
name: '商品A',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}, {
name: '商品B',
type: 'bar',
data: [10, 20, 25, 15, 15, 30]
}, {
name: '商品C',
type: 'bar',
data: [15, 25, 30, 20, 20, 35]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
2. 产品关联分析
在电商领域,产品之间的关联性对于营销策略至关重要。通过echarts堆积图,我们可以分析不同产品之间的销量关系,从而发现潜在的销售机会。
示例代码:
// 引入echarts
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: '产品关联分析'
},
tooltip: {},
legend: {
data:['商品A', '商品B', '商品C']
},
xAxis: {
data: ["商品A", "商品B", "商品C"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 10, 15]
}, {
name: '商品A',
type: 'bar',
stack: '总量',
data: [5, 8, 10]
}, {
name: '商品B',
type: 'bar',
stack: '总量',
data: [3, 5, 5]
}, {
name: '商品C',
type: 'bar',
stack: '总量',
data: [2, 3, 5]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
三、总结
echarts堆积图作为一种强大的可视化工具,在电商数据分析中具有广泛的应用。通过堆积图,我们可以轻松解读销量趋势和产品关联,为电商运营提供有力支持。希望本文能帮助您更好地利用echarts堆积图,挖掘电商数据中的价值。
